The Body Shop® difference: Our cocoa butter comes from our Community Trade partner, Kuapa Kokoo Ltd., which means “good cocoa farmers”, in Ghana. But Community Trade is about far more than exchanging goods for money. According to Anita Roddick, “Community Trade is about how people make their living, how they feed their families, how they educate their children. It’s all about relationships; about listening to each other, learning from each other, developing a community’s ability to stand on its own two feet.”
